Cellular One
 2 Out of 5
Phone Model: Motorola V551
|
Abbott / Lake Otis / About 1 Mi NE of Intersection, Anchorage, AK 99507 |
Mon Apr 10, 2006 |
I can make and receive calls about 80% of the time, and service typically shows as 1-2 out of 5 bars of service. Conversations are workable but far from perfect. Cellular One must have just added a tower somewhere near my neighborhood--before February, I typically had 0-1 bars of reception and about 20% of my calls worked. Still, the area is lacking in good coverage. Not sure where the nearest towers are. I don't know about ACS coverage in this area, but my ACS EV-DO wireless broadband works intermittently at my house. EV-DO signal can range anywhere from 0-3 bars (out of 4). When the card loses the high-speed EV-DO carrier and falls back to the slower 1xRTT--which works [almost] anywhere there is voice coverage--the reception shoots up to 4 bars. That makes me think there is an ACS tower very near that simply hasn't been retrofitted with the EV-DO service--but ACS (CDMA) voice service may be good in my area. I do not have an ACS phone to verify this. (If I do verify this, I may end up switching!)
